Sat 1366600836789240
- decimal
- 336640.836789240
- degree
- 0°126640′1984″836789240‴
- percentile
- 65.07623039488102%
- name
- eeayudoqnlp
- cycle
- 0
- epoch
- 1
- period
- 166
- block
- 336640
- offset
- 836789240
- timestamp
- rarity
- common
- inscriptions
- location
- 463655195f64cd2810a47dc142f04ce7bfc41a3f46427158a97d045609d32b7c:4:711011138
- address
- bc1qpwlmn5prlslmk0sryj9lj28wfvpe8wzfkpcxhg7p5aafxzwr0vtqpvljsg